Transaction c89638cb74c52c7f04fa63c11592621243163175e75790dfedcdef095570901a
1 Input
1 Output
-
c89638cb74c52c7f04fa63c11592621243163175e75790dfedcdef095570901a:0
- value
- 265900
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6112129cd0382051dc5cf4b5b3770b1892cf993
- address
- bc1qucgjz2wdqwpq28w9ea94kdmskxyje7vnv8egcy